我們把不屬於其他類別的函數歸納到雜項函數類別。
雜項函數是PHP 核心的組成部分。無需安裝即可使用這些函數。
雜項函數的行為受php.ini 檔案中的設定的影響。
雜項配置選項:
名稱 | 預設 | 描述 | 可更改 |
---|---|---|---|
ignore_user_abort | "0" | FALSE 指示只要腳本在用戶端終止連線後嘗試輸出,腳本就會終止。 | PHP_INI_ALL |
highlight.string | "#DD0000" | 供突出顯示符合PHP 語法的字串而使用的顏色。 | PHP_INI_ALL |
highlight.comment | "#FF8000" | 供突出顯示PHP 註解而使用的顏色。 | PHP_INI_ALL |
highlight.keyword | "#007700" | 供語法高亮顯示PHP 關鍵字而使用的顏色(如圓括號和分號)。 | PHP_INI_ALL |
highlight.bg | "#FFFFFF" | 背景顏色。 | PHP_INI_ALL |
highlight.default | "#0000BB" | PHP 語法的預設顏色。 | PHP_INI_ALL |
highlight.html | "#000000" | HTML 程式碼的顏色。 | PHP_INI_ALL |
browscap | NULL | 瀏覽器效能檔案(例如:browscap.ini)的名稱和位置。 | PHP_INI_SYSTEM |
PHP :指示支援該函數的最早的PHP 版本。
函數 | 描述 | PHP |
---|---|---|
connection_aborted() | 檢查是否斷開客戶機。 | 3 |
connection_status() | 傳回目前的連線狀態。 | 3 |
connection_timeout() | 在PHP 4.0.5 中不贊成使用。檢查腳本是否超時。 | 3 |
constant() | 傳回一個常數的值。 | 4 |
define() | 定義一個常數。 | 3 |
defined() | 檢查某常量是否存在。 | 3 |
die() | 輸出一則訊息,並退出目前腳本。 | 3 |
eval() | 把字串當成PHP 程式碼來計算。 | 3 |
exit() | 輸出一則訊息,並退出目前腳本。 | 3 |
get_browser() | 返回使用者瀏覽器的效能。 | 3 |
highlight_file() | 對檔案進行PHP 語法高亮顯示。 | 4 |
highlight_string() | 對字串進行PHP 語法高亮顯示。 | 4 |
ignore_user_abort() | 設定與遠端客戶機斷開是否會終止腳本的執行。 | 3 |
pack() | 把資料裝入一個二進位字串。 | 3 |
php_check_syntax() | 在PHP 5.0.5 中不贊成使用。 | 5 |
php_strip_whitespace() | 傳回已刪除PHP 註解以及空白字元的原始程式碼檔案。 | 5 |
show_source() | highlight_file() 的別名。 | 4 |
sleep() | 延遲程式碼執行若干秒。 | 3 |
time_nanosleep() | 延遲程式碼執行若干秒和奈秒。 | 5 |
time_sleep_until() | 延遲代碼執行直到指定的時間。 | 5 |
uniqid() | 產生唯一的ID。 | 3 |
unpack() | 從二進位字串對資料進行解包。 | 3 |
usleep() | 延遲程式碼執行若干微秒。 | 3 |
PHP :指示支援該常數的最早的PHP 版本。
常量 | 描述 | PHP |
---|---|---|
CONNECTION_ABORTED | ||
CONNECTION_NORMAL | ||
CONNECTION_TIMEOUT | ||
__COMPILER_HALT_OFFSET__ | 5 |